Baghor Post Office - PIN 486670

Baghor is a Speed Post Branch Post Office (Dak Ghar) in Sidhi, Madhya Pradesh which delivers mail and accepts bookings. The Postal Department of India has allotted PIN code 486670 to this office. Baghor PO is situated in the Sihawal taluk, Sihawal postal sub-district, Jabalpur Region postal region, Rewa Division postal division under the Madhya Pradesh Circle postal circle.

What is a DIGIPIN?

DIGIPIN is India Post's free Digital PIN: a 10-character code that pinpoints any location to a ~4-metre square. Find the DIGIPIN of your current location, or decode a DIGIPIN to see it on the map.
